Management highlights

Key highlights include: Asset-based truckload operations (Expedited and Dedicated) grew average tractor count by 169 units (7.9%), freight revenue by $11.4 million (7.2%), and adjusted operating income by $1.6 million (12.6%). Asset-light operations (Managed Freight and Warehousing) saw freight revenue down $6.2 million (6.5%) but total adjusted operating income only down $0.2 million (3.0%). Net capital investment for revenue producing equipment was ~$18 million. Fleet average age improved to 20 months from 23 months. Net indebtedness declined to $236.7 million, with an adjusted leverage ratio of 1.6 times and debt-to-capital ratio of 35.4%. Return on invested capital was 8.1% for the quarter versus 10% in the prior year.

Segment performance

Expedited: Freight revenue was $87.4 million with adjusted operating income of $7 million, resulting in an adjusted operating ratio of 92. The segment was impacted by softer volumes and imbalanced network. Dedicated: Freight revenue grew by $15.7 million (23.5%) and adjusted operating income grew by $3.2 million (73.9%), with an adjusted operating ratio of 91. Managed Freight: Freight revenue decreased by 9.1% and adjusted operating profit by 29.5%, with an adjusted operating ratio of 95.7, due to lower profitable volumes and cargo claims. Warehousing: Freight revenue increased by 0.5% and adjusted operating profit by 85.1%, with an adjusted operating ratio of 91.5, showing improved profitability after prior challenges. TEL: Pre-tax net income was $4 million for the quarter compared to $5.3 million in the prior year, with revenue up 6% but pre-tax net income down ~24% due to a soft equipment market and higher interest expense.

Guidance

The general freight market is expected to remain challenging despite improving fundamentals, with uncertainty about demand improvement pace. The fourth quarter is expected to have momentum to improve operations and execute opportunities regardless of the freight market. CapEx is expected to be lower in 2025, around $50-60 million, mostly for maintenance CapEx with some growth CapEx early in the year.

Risks

Soft freight volumes affecting the Expedited segment. Proliferation of brokers and small carriers negatively impacting market rebound. Higher interest rates affecting TEL's performance.

Q&A highlights

Q: About demand environment and Q4 post-storms A: Paul Bunn stated softness carried over from September to October in the Expedited network, with some uptick around hurricanes but fading quickly. David Parker added the freight market is still at the bottom waiting for a catalyst.

Q: Pricing in coming cycle A: David Parker expects 2%-3% rate increases, with potential for more in the second half of the year, noting customers are not expecting no rate increases for three years.

Q: CapEx in 2025 A: Tripp Grant said CapEx is expected to be lower in 2025, around $50-60 million, mostly for maintenance CapEx, with some growth CapEx already bought and paid for early in the year.

Q: Longer-term market changes A: Paul Bunn mentioned specialized businesses continue to perform well, while proliferation of brokers and small carriers hinder market rebound. David Parker added domestic industrial production and election impact could affect the market.

Q: Cash flow and acquisitions A: Paul Bunn and Tripp Grant discussed being patient with acquisitions, looking for niche, stable businesses, and CapEx reduction is building cash for potential acquisitions.
